Weight overlap is an ETFIQ calculation: for every security both funds hold, the smaller of the two weights, summed. Above 50%, holding both is close to holding one of them twice. Holdings dated Jun 30, 2026.

IWF in plain words
IWF is an index equity fund tracking the Russell 1000 growth. Over the year to Sep 11, 2026 it returned +7.0% with distributions reinvested, against +17.5% for the S&P 500 and +23.0% for the Nasdaq-100. The prospectus expense ratio is 0.18% a year. By its holdings filed for Jun 30, 2026, 94% of the fund by weight is stocks the S&P 500 also holds, across 368 positions, with the top ten at 54.4%. It sat 5.0% below its high of Jun 1, 2026 on Sep 11, 2026.
